Meaning of Cal

The name Cal is of English origin and is a short form of the name Calvin. It is derived from the French name Calvin, which means 'little bald one'. While the name Cal is often used as a nickname for Calvin, it can also be used as a standalone name.

Origin of Cal

The name Cal has its roots in the French name Calvin, which was introduced to England by the Normans in the 11th century. The name Calvin became popular in the 16th century due to the influence of the Protestant reformer John Calvin. The name Cal, as a standalone name, has been used in English-speaking countries since the 19th century.

Popularity of Cal

While the name Cal is not as popular as some other baby boy names, it has been steadily increasing in popularity in recent years. In 2020, the name Cal ranked #645 in the United States, up from #711 in 2019. In England and Wales, the name Cal did not rank in the top 1000 baby boy names in 2020.

Famous People Named Cal

There are several famous people named Cal, including: 1. Cal Ripken Jr. - former Major League Baseball player 2. Cal Kestis - fictional character in the video game 'Star Wars Jedi: Fallen Order' 3. Cal Chetley - character in the movie 'Legendary' 4. Cal Naughton Jr. - character in the movie 'Talladega Nights: The Ballad of Ricky Bobby' These individuals have helped to bring attention to the name Cal and make it a recognizable name in popular culture.
